(ADAPTADA) Na AULA 2 aprendemos que a linguagem Python apresenta algumas regras a serem seguidas para que nossos programas não gerem erros. Aprendemos também a escrever uma mensagem na tela empregando um comando de saída. Lembrando das regras apresentadas, observe as 4 linhas de print a seguir:
print()
print(' ')
print('APOL)
print('')
Somente uma destas 4 linhas gera erro na saída do programa. Assinale a alternativa que CORRETAMENTE indica qual das linhas gera erro e o motivo deste erro.
A Linha 1, porque não foi colocado nenhuma informação dentro dos parênteses para fazermos a impressão na tela.
B Linha 2, porque foi aberto aspas simples mas nenhum texto foi colocado dentro dela, somente um espaço em branco.
C Linha 3, porque as aspas simples foram abertas mas não foram fechadas.
D Linha 4, porque foi aberto aspas simples mas nenhum texto foi colocado dentro dela.
Respostas
A única linha que gera erro é a linha 3, porque as aspas simples foram abertas mas não foram fechadas. Opção C.
A função print em Python é usada para escrever na saída padrão do seu computador, geralmente a tela, alguma informação.
Sendo assim, a forma correta de se usar esse comando é:
- print('Testo a ser escrito na tela')
Ou seja, damos o comando print, abre parênteses, escreve o testo a ser escrito entre aspas simples ou aspas duplas.
Atenção: não misturar aspas simples e duplas, se abrir aspas simples fechar com aspas simples, se abrir aspas duplas, fechar com aspas duplas e vice-versa.
Também podemos usar o comando para exibir uma informação armazenada em uma variável, dessa forma basta darmos o comando e passar a variável dentro do parênteses, sem aspas.
- print(variavel)
Quando enviamos um comando print sem nenhum parâmetro dentro do parênteses, o python entende que deve ser escrito uma linha em branco e exibe essa linha em branco na saída padrão. Por tanto, o primeiro comando exibe uma linha em branco e não exibe o erro.
Quando enviamos o comando print com aspas abertas e dentro dela apenas um espaço, o python escreve na tela o espaço escrito, pois espaço também é considerado texto.
Quando enviamos o comando print com aspas abertas, mas sem fechar, mesmo que não tenha nenhum texto escrito dentro dela é erro, pois o python não consegue identificar qual é o final do argumento passado.
Por fim, enviar o comando print com aspas abertas e fechadas sem nada dentro, também dá certo, visto que o python identifica como um elemento nulo e também o escreve na tela como um formato de linha pulada.
Mais exercícios sobre python em:
https://brainly.com.br/tarefa/51160074
https://brainly.com.br/tarefa/31321477
https://brainly.com.br/tarefa/47294993
#SPJ1
Resposta: C)
Explicação: Linha 3, porque as aspas simples foram abertas mas não foram fechadas!